Marva Warnock, a talented graphic artist and the wife of Adobe co-founder John Warnock, designed the company’s original logo in 1982. At the time, the startup lacked the funds to hire an external agency, so Marva stepped in to create a professional identity from their kitchen table. Her design featured a bold, stylized "A" with a distinct open triangular crossbar, paired with a futuristic wordmark where the "E" consisted of three simple horizontal stripes. Set against a dark grey background, this geometric emblem became an instant classic. Her clean, modern aesthetic proved so enduring that the iconic "A" remains the core of Adobe’s global brand identity more than forty years later.

John Pasche, born April 24, 1945, is a British graphic designer who graduated with a BA from Brighton College of Art (1963–1967) and an MA from the Royal College of Art (1967–1970). In 1970, while still a student, Pasche was recommended to Mick Jagger to design a poster for The Rolling Stones’ European tour. Impressed, Jagger commissioned him to create a logo for their new record label. Inspired by Jagger’s mention of the Hindu goddess Kali and her protruding tongue, Pasche designed the iconic “Tongue and Lips” logo in 1970, debuting on the Sticky Fingers album in 1971. The bold, red design, symbolizing rebellion, became a global rock icon. Pasche was paid £50 initially, later selling the copyright for £26,000 in 1984. The original artwork sold to the Victoria and Albert Museum for $92,500 in 2008.

Jane Baer, a beloved Disney artist whose work helped bring countless animated classics to life, has passed away at the age of 91.

Throughout her career, she contributed to timeless films that shaped generations, lending her artistry and creativity to characters and stories that became part of childhoods around the world. From enchanting fairy tales to unforgettable animated adventures, her work carried the magic that defined Disney’s golden eras.

Her legacy lives on in the colors, characters, and moments that continue to inspire audiences of all ages.
